Hold on to your steering wheels, folks! After months of anticipation, the moment has finally arrived. Tesla’s Full Self-Driving Beta v11 is set to be released to the masses this weekend, as confirmed by none other than Elon Musk himself. This is a major milestone for the automotive industry, as Tesla takes a significant step … (read full article...)